#430af5 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#430af5 is composed of 26.3% red, 3.9%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.7% cyan, 95.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 254.6 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 50%. #430af5 color hex could be obtained by blending #8614ff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

● #430af5 color description : Vivid blue.
The hexadecimal color #430af5 has RGB values of R:67, G:10,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 4393717.
